There is quite a debate about what constitutes post treatment effects and whether they are down to the medication or not. There is a very interesting survey on a British Hep C  site which is collecting post treatment side effects and shows that 30% plus of people are reporting a range of symptoms, amongst which joint pain is of the most common.

I had no joint pain before or during treatment but a few weeks after I stopped i got very noticeable pain and weakness in my knees which made it difficult (but not impossible) to walk. This went away after a bit and I got painful and weak wrists which made it hard to lower myself into a bathtub and harder to lift myself out. That also faded after a month or two, and it moved to my fingers and thumbs. The affected fingers get very swollen and sore, but after a time this too improves. It tends to affect one area at a time but it is still a problem 21 months after treatment. I am lucky in that it doesn't really affect my life too much. I wake up with a lot of joint pain each morning, but it eases off as I move about.  

I can't say whether your hip joint pain is a similar thing to mine, but I would hazard a guess that it is. The length of time people have to put up with this seems to vary a lot. Good luck and I hope your symptoms improve soon.
